Understanding the Limits of Calorie Tracking
Calorie Counter PRO MyNetDiary can be a useful organizational tool, but it should not be treated as a replacement for medical care or individualized nutrition advice. Food database values, portion estimates, and calorie calculations may not be exact in every situation. Individual nutritional needs can also vary based on age, activity, health status, medications, and other personal factors. Users with medical conditions, specialized dietary needs, or concerns about eating habits should consult a qualified healthcare professional or registered dietitian for guidance.
